State two characteristics shared by elements of the same group in the periodic table

Groups are vertical columns in the Periodic Table and they contain elements with similar properties. One characteristic is that each member of a group has the same number of electrons in the outer level. This holds true for groups 1-7. Because each element has the same number of electrons in the outer shell, they tend to have similar properties(second characteristic).
